Hi Delphine,

Handing over the Ladlewise recipe-scaling calculator before my rotation ends. The scaling math is pure application code; the database only stores ingredient conversion factors and saved batch presets. New team members should know the conversions table is read-heavy and cached for five minutes. For direct inspection or preset cleanup, use the following connection:

primary connection of yagep-kahip = redis://giliel_svc:zYiKsLL2PLpfPL@db-348f.xolmarsys.corp:5432/fenwyn

## Break-glass: Lumenquery autocomplete index

If autocomplete latency spikes past the red line and paging Ostrev gets no response in 15 minutes, you're allowed to break glass. This drops the suggestion index to the smaller fallback trie — searches get dumber but stay fast. It's reversible, so don't panic. To open the break-glass console and trigger the fallback, enter the passphrase provided below.

strongbox words: prawyn-fenmir

Subject: Sorting stability guaranteed in report builder 3.9

Plugin authors,

As of Corvette Reports 3.9, multi-column sorts are stable: rows with equal keys preserve their prior order. Plugins relying on the old nondeterministic tie-breaking should drop any workarounds. Custom comparators must now be pure functions. Verified against the fixture suite on the build below.

pipeline stamp: htk9_6ce9d33c5

Subject: Key rotation — LogTrim sampling service

Hello,

As part of the quarterly review, we rotated the credential used by LogTrim, which samples logs from the notoriously chatty Quillfeed service before they reach cold storage. The old key is revoked effective today; sampling rates are unchanged. The replacement key for the LogTrim ingest API is below.

service key, fawip-bajef: kto11_Qt5wZK9vdNC

// WAVEFORM_PREVIEW_BUCKETS controls how many amplitude samples the
// Soundline player renders in the mini preview strip. Support: if a
// customer reports a flat or jagged waveform, this is usually the
// culprit after a cache purge, not corrupt audio. Values above 512
// slow older tablets; below 64 the preview looks blocky. Do not edit
// without pinging the Brightreel media team. When escalating, quote
// the customer's clip length plus the token printed on the line below.

trace token, fafog-kageg: htk4_98e6